Natan Linder, our 100th guest, is CEO and co-founder of Tulip, a manufacturing software company that builds digital applications to bridge the human-automation gap for frontline operations. Tulip’s platforms are based on over a decade’s worth of breakthrough research by world-class experts on technologies such as the Internet of Things (IoT), human-computer interaction, augmented reality, and machine learning. Natan is also co-founder and chairman of Formlabs, which develops affordable high-resolution 3D printing for professionals in a diverse set of industries and serves as an advisory board member of RightHand Robotics. He was a former Intel Fellow in the Fluid Interfaces Group at MIT Media Lab and co-founder of Samsung Telecom. He earned his doctorate in media arts and science at MIT and a BA in Computer Science and Business Administration at Reichman University.
